首页 >> 日常问答 >

计算机if语句

2025-07-21 14:49:04

计算机if语句】在编程中,`if`语句是控制程序流程的重要结构之一。它允许程序根据特定条件决定执行哪一部分代码。通过`if`语句,程序可以实现分支逻辑,使程序更具灵活性和智能性。

一、if语句的基本结构

`if`语句的语法结构如下:

```python

if 条件:

条件为真时执行的代码块

```

当条件成立(即为`True`)时,执行缩进后的代码;否则,跳过该部分。

二、if语句的扩展形式

除了基本的`if`语句外,还有以下几种常见的扩展形式:

语句类型 语法结构 功能说明
if `if 条件:` 当条件为真时执行代码
if-else `if 条件:\n...\nelse:\n...` 条件为真时执行第一个代码块,否则执行第二个
if-elif-else `if 条件1:\n...\nelif 条件2:\n...\nelse:\n...` 多个条件判断,按顺序检查,满足一个后不再继续

三、常见应用场景

`if`语句广泛应用于各种编程场景中,例如:

- 数据验证:检查用户输入是否符合要求。

- 条件判断:根据不同的情况执行不同的操作。

- 流程控制:控制程序的运行路径。

四、注意事项

1. 缩进问题:Python使用缩进来区分代码块,必须保持一致的缩进。

2. 逻辑表达式:条件应为布尔值(`True`或`False`),可使用比较运算符或逻辑运算符组合。

3. 避免冗余判断:合理设计条件逻辑,提高代码效率。

五、示例代码

```python

age = int(input("请输入你的年龄:"))

if age >= 18:

print("你已成年。")

else:

print("你还未成年。")

```

此代码根据用户输入的年龄判断是否成年,并输出相应信息。

通过掌握`if`语句的使用,可以有效提升程序的逻辑处理能力,是学习编程的基础内容之一。

  免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。

 
分享:
最新文章